FIX ERROR – fdisk: DOS partition table format cannot be used on drives for volumes larger than 2199023255040 bytes for 512-byte sectors

When trying to create a partition with the “fdisk” utility, 2 or more TB in size, the following message appears:

The size of this disk is 2 TiB (2199023255552 bytes). DOS partition table format cannot be used on drives for volumes larger than 2199023255040 bytes for 512-byte sectors. Use GUID partition table format (GPT).

 

Solution:

Add the “gpt” label on the new disk

parted /dev/nvme2n1

 

Where “nvme2n1” – is your disk

 

Add the label:

mklabel gpt

 

Checking:

print

 

 

Then we return to fdisk and create the desired partition. The section can also be created in the “parted” utility

 

Let’s create a file system, for this we copy the full path of the created partition

 

And we create a file system, in this example it’s ext4:

mkfs.ext4 /dev/nvme2n1p1
